Output 3a1d1c1bd6dfc7313c34574ea44f26fd5dd45b652afb667be81d8032f1a70586:60

value
36493
script pubkey
OP_HASH160 OP_PUSHBYTES_20 20ba31cac5375c2054a0c571679f72d74f25812c OP_EQUAL
address
34g4bhjAwVPiHuPXF2Q3M3yZ2EYQMGijJP
transaction
3a1d1c1bd6dfc7313c34574ea44f26fd5dd45b652afb667be81d8032f1a70586
spent
true